随着互联网的快速发展,网站建设已经成为了现代企业和个人展示自己形象、传播信息的重要手段。对于前端开发人员来说,网站的开发过程却是一个既复杂又繁琐的工作,涉及到众多的细节和繁复的代码编写。因此,如何在开发过程中提高工作效率,并确保最终成果的高质量,成为了每个开发者都需要思考的问题。
在这个过程中,HTML框架代码的应用无疑是一项不可忽视的重要工具。HTML框架代码不仅能够帮助开发者简化开发流程,还能提升网站的可维护性和响应能力。今天,我们就来深入了解HTML框架代码的定义、作用以及如何巧妙地将其运用到网站开发中,助你更高效、更轻松地打造出功能完善且外观美观的网页。
什么是HTML框架代码?
HTML框架代码,通常指的是一组预设的HTML结构和样式代码,可以帮助开发者快速搭建网站的基础框架,省去从零开始编写HTML代码的繁琐步骤。框架代码一般包含了页面的基本布局、常用的HTML标签和样式表、以及对响应式设计和兼容性优化的支持。通过使用框架代码,开发者可以在很短的时间内完成网页的基础建设,将更多的精力集中于网页内容的创作和功能的实现上。
目前,市面上有许多流行的HTML框架,如Bootstrap、Foundation、TailwindCSS等,它们都提供了一些常用的HTML组件、样式和JavaScript插件。开发者可以根据自己的需求选择合适的框架,快速实现网站的开发目标。
HTML框架代码的优势
提升开发效率:
HTML框架代码最大的优势就是能够大大提高开发效率。通过使用框架代码,开发者无需从零开始编写基础布局和样式,框架提供的预设结构能够让开发者节省大量的时间。更重要的是,框架通常已经进行了优化,能够保证代码的高效性和兼容性,使得开发者能够将更多的精力投入到网页的功能实现和细节优化上。
一致的设计和布局:
在开发过程中,网页的设计风格和布局的一致性非常重要。HTML框架代码通常会提供一套统一的设计标准和组件,开发者只需调用框架中的样式和组件,就可以确保页面元素的布局和风格保持一致。这种一致性不仅提升了用户体验,也有助于网页的维护和更新。
响应式设计:
随着移动互联网的普及,响应式设计已经成为现代网站的标配。HTML框架代码中的许多框架都内置了响应式布局支持,能够自动适应不同屏幕尺寸和设备类型。这意味着,使用框架代码开发的网站能够在手机、平板和电脑等设备上良好显示,极大地提升了网站的访问体验。
社区支持与丰富的插件:
由于HTML框架代码的广泛应用,许多框架都拥有强大的社区支持,开发者可以轻松找到框架的使用教程、文档以及问题的解决方案。许多框架还提供了大量的插件,能够快速为网站添加各种功能,如滑动动画、图片画廊、模态窗口等,这为开发者提供了极大的便利。
代码结构清晰易维护:
使用HTML框架代码能够帮助开发者规范化代码结构,使得网站的开发过程更加有条理。这种规范化的代码结构不仅方便了开发人员的协作,还能有效地减少后期维护的难度。在多人开发的团队项目中,统一的框架代码能够大大降低开发过程中的沟通成本。
常见的HTML框架代码
Bootstrap:
作为最流行的HTML框架之一,Bootstrap被广泛应用于各类网页的开发中。它由Twitter的开发者创建,提供了一整套响应式布局和UI组件,包括导航栏、按钮、表单、图标等,极大地方便了前端开发者的工作。Bootstrap还支持自定义主题,能够根据不同的项目需求进行灵活调整。
Foundation:
Foundation是另一个备受欢迎的HTML框架,拥有类似于Bootstrap的功能。它提供了丰富的HTML和CSS组件,同时也支持响应式设计和移动端优化。与Bootstrap相比,Foundation更加注重灵活性和自定义,适合需要高度定制化的网站开发项目。
TailwindCSS:
TailwindCSS是一种功能更为强大的CSS框架,与传统的UI框架有所不同。它采用了“原子化设计”的思路,提供了大量的小型、可组合的CSS类,开发者可以通过简单地组合这些类来构建复杂的布局和设计。这种方式能够让开发者更高效地控制样式,提高代码的重用性。
Materialize:
Materialize是基于Google的MaterialDesign规范的HTML框架,提供了一整套符合MaterialDesign风格的UI组件。它支持响应式设计和动态效果,适合那些想要构建现代、简洁风格网站的开发者。
如何使用HTML框架代码?
虽然HTML框架代码可以大大简化开发过程,但在使用过程中,开发者也需要注意一些事项。在选择框架时,要根据项目的具体需求来选择最合适的框架。例如,如果项目需要一个简单的布局和组件,Bootstrap可能是最合适的选择;而如果项目需要高度定制化和灵活的布局,TailwindCSS则可能更加适合。
开发者需要熟悉框架的基本用法,包括如何引入框架文件、如何使用框架提供的组件和样式等。大多数HTML框架都提供了详细的文档和教程,开发者可以根据文档进行学习和实践。框架的版本更新和兼容性问题也是需要注意的事项,开发者在使用框架时要确保选择的版本能够与项目的其他技术栈兼容。
HTML框架代码的应用不仅限于前端开发人员,它对整个开发团队的协作和沟通也起到了积极的促进作用。在多人的开发团队中,框架代码能够为团队成员提供一个共同的开发基础,减少不同开发人员在编码过程中出现的风格差异和冲突,提高团队的工作效率和代码质量。
HTML框架代码在网站开发中的实践
1.快速构建响应式网站
随着移动设备的普及,网站需要适配各种设备屏幕,这要求网站能够根据不同设备的屏幕尺寸和分辨率进行自适应调整。HTML框架代码提供了响应式设计的支持,使得开发者能够在开发网站时,不必担心不同设备之间的显示问题。框架通过灵活的栅格系统和媒体查询,能够根据屏幕宽度自动调整布局,确保网站在手机、平板和桌面设备上都能完美呈现。
例如,Bootstrap框架内置了响应式的栅格系统,通过简单的类名组合,开发者可以轻松实现网页内容在不同设备上的自适应布局,而不需要编写复杂的CSS媒体查询。这种便捷的方式大大提高了开发效率,也让响应式设计变得更加普及。
2.增强网站的可维护性和扩展性
HTML框架代码不仅能够帮助开发者快速构建网站的基础结构,还能够提高网站的可维护性和扩展性。通过框架代码提供的规范化结构,开发者能够更轻松地管理和维护项目中的代码,减少了因代码冗余或重复造成的混乱。框架通常还会提供许多常用的UI组件和插件,这些组件和插件经过精心设计和优化,能够帮助开发者更高效地实现网站功能和特效。
例如,使用Bootstrap框架中的模态框组件,可以快速实现弹窗效果,而不需要从头开始编写复杂的HTML、CSS和JavaScript代码。框架中的组件通常会支持自定义和配置,开发者可以根据实际需求调整样式和功能,使得网站在扩展时更加灵活和方便。
3.提高网站性能和兼容性
性能和兼容性是网站开发中不可忽视的问题。HTML框架代码经过多次优化,能够帮助开发者提高网站的加载速度和运行效率。框架通常会提供一些内置的性能优化功能,如图片懒加载、压缩CSS和JavaScript文件等,能够有效地减少网站的加载时间。
HTML框架代码还会关注网站的兼容性问题,框架中的组件和样式通常经过广泛的测试,确保能够在各种主流浏览器和设备上正常运行。这意味着,开发者可以在使用框架时,减少因为浏览器差异导致的显示问题,确保网站在不同环境中的一致性。
总结
HTML框架代码的出现和广泛应用,无疑为网站开发带来了革命性的变化。通过框架代码,开发者能够大大提高开发效率,确保网站的高质量和高性能。无论是构建响应式网站、增强网站的可维护性,还是提高网站的兼容性,HTML框架代码都能够发挥重要作用。对于前端开发人员而言,掌握HTML框架代码的使用,无疑是一项必不可少的技能。